The breakup of Pangaea occurred in several stages over millions of years. It started with the rifting of Pangaea into two supercontinents, Laurasia and Gondwana, during the Triassic period. This was followed by further breakup into the continents we know today during the Jurassic and Cretaceous periods.
The Atlantic Ocean was created by the breakup of the supercontinent Pangaea. As Pangaea began to separate into the continents we know today, the Atlantic Ocean formed in between them through the process of seafloor spreading.
The breakup of Pangaea occurred during the Mesozoic Era, specifically during the Jurassic and Cretaceous periods. This process led to the formation of the modern continents we know today.
The breakup of Pangaea occurred due to the movement of tectonic plates. Over millions of years, the immense forces of plate tectonics caused Pangaea to gradually break apart into separate continents that drifted away from each other. This process resulted in the formation of the continents as we know them today.

No, the breakup of Pangaea occurred long before the mass extinction of dinosaurs. The main factor believed to have caused dinosaur extinction is an asteroid impact that occurred around 66 million years ago.

The breakup of the supercontinent, known as Pangaea, was primarily caused by plate tectonics. Over millions of years, the movement of Earth's lithospheric plates caused Pangaea to break apart into the continents we know today. This process, called continental drift, was driven by the convection currents in the Earth's mantle.
